Boyd Team's Theory Predicts a Way Around Bandwidth Limit

July 19, 2017

Prof. Robert BoydA new publication in Science by a team including The Institute's Prof. Robert Boyd uses electromagnetic theory to predict a means to surpass a bandwidth limit for "high-Q systems."  The "quality," or "Q," of a system represents how easily the system can absorb energy at its natural resonant frequency.  According to the article, higher-Q systems have narrower bandwidth--a narrower range of frequency over which they can absorb energy--but this range may be broader in "asymmetric systems."  The abstract (and full text for AAAS members) is here.
